// Configuration Space Access Mechanism #1
 | 
			
		||||
#define CONFIG_ADDRESS 0xCF8 // Configuration adress that is to be accessed
 | 
			
		||||
#define CONFIG_DATA 0xCFC // Will do the actual configuration operation
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
/*
 | 
			
		||||
CONFIG_ADDRESS 
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
32 bit register 
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
bit 31      Enable bit      (Should CONFIG_DATA be translatedc to configuration cycles)      
 | 
			
		||||
bit 30 - 24 Reserved    
 | 
			
		||||
bit 23 - 16 Bus Number      (Choose a specific PCI BUS)
 | 
			
		||||
bit 15 - 11 Device Number   (Selects specific device one the pci bus)
 | 
			
		||||
bit 10 - 8  Function Number (Selects a specific function in a device)
 | 
			
		||||
bit 7 -  0  Register Offset (Offset in the configuration space of 256 Bytes ) NOTE: lowest two bits will always be zero 
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
*/

/* 
 | 
			
		||||
PCI Device structure
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
Register    offset  bits 31-24  bits 23-16  bits 15-8   bits 7-0
 | 
			
		||||
00          00      Device ID   <----       Vendor  ID  <-------
 | 
			
		||||
01          04      Status      <----       Command     <-------
 | 
			
		||||
02          08      Class code  Sub class   Prog IF     Revision ID
 | 
			
		||||
03          0C      BIST        Header Type Ltncy Timer Cache line Size
 | 
			
		||||
04          10      Base address #0 (BAR0) 
 | 
			
		||||
05          14      Base address #1 (BAR1) 
 | 
			
		||||
06          18      Base address #2 (BAR2) 
 | 
			
		||||
07          1C      Base address #3 (BAR3)
 | 
			
		||||
08          20      Base address #4 (BAR4)
 | 
			
		||||
09          24      Base address #5 (BAR5)
 | 
			
		||||
0A          28      Cardbus CIS Pointer
 | 
			
		||||
0B          2C      Subsystem ID <------   Subsystem Vendor ID  <-------
 | 
			
		||||
0C          30      Expansion ROM base address
 | 
			
		||||
0D          34      Reserved     <-------   Capabilities Pointer <------
 | 
			
		||||
0E          38      Reserved    <-------    <--------   <--------
 | 
			
		||||
0F          3C      Max ltncy   Min Grant   Interrupt PIN   Interrupt Line
